Re bonjour,
voila j'ai suivi la FAQ de developpez.com
et elle dis que l'on peut stocker resultat de l'execution d'un programme dans un tableau.
Voici donc mon code:
Or mon résultat est du type
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6 @sortie = `/usr/local/nagios/libexec/check_nrpe -H $hostname -c check_cpu -n`; print "$sortie[0] \n"; print "$sortie[1] \n"; print "$sortie[2] \n"; print "$sortie[3] \n"; print "$sortie[4] \n";
Et je voudrais stocker chaque mot dans une case...OK : use 18 % idle : 82
En gros, la question est peut-on definir un séparateur de champ (ici espace) qui me permettrai de stocker correctement mon resultat
Merci
Partager